A blood examination shows megaloblastic anemia with low folate. Which condition is most likely?
- Correct Answer: Folate deficiency anemia
- Vitamin B12 deficiency
- Thalassemia
- Sideroblastic anemia
Explanation: Folate deficiency anemia presents with megaloblastic anemia and low folate levels.
